Air Alternating Overlay Support System
The Air-Lo 3 Alternating Overlay leads the field in affordable prevention of pressure areas and skin breakdowns where a lower profile overlay for lighter patients is desirable.
It’s compact, powerful yet almost silent control unit can quickly support patient loads of up to 100kg whilst alternately allowing pressure to be released across the rest of the body.
When an affordable support and therapy system is required, the Air-Lo 3 Alternating Overlay is the best value choice for safely caring for patients assessed at risk of developing pressure areas.
An optional internal Air-Lo Hyper-Stretch Coverlet can easily be fitted under all AirLo top covers to ensure maximum patient comfort and insulation.
High quality two way stretch top cover is fully welded and can be high temperature
washed for total infection control.
Elasticised side straps securely bond the
overlay to any regular single mattress.
Power cord is run inside the mattress to avoid dangerous
threading under the bed or on the floor.
Easy to use analogue control unit features a manual comfort dial, static mode with a 60 minute auto time-out and simple diagnostics. Intermittent operation ensures long pump life.
All waterfalls are turned and welded for maximum infection control and zip protection.
22 pure TPU transverse air cells alternate one in every two. They stretch under the patient to provide maximum comfort, prevention and therapy.
Static head section eliminates patient dizziness and disorientation.

5 Air Alternating Overlay with Auto Tilt Sensor & Heel Suspension
The Air-Lo 5 Alternating Overlay leads the field in affordable prevention of pressure areas and skin breakdowns where a complete mattresses replacement is undesirable.
It’s compact, powerful yet almost silent control unit can quickly support patient loads of up to 120kg whilst alternately allowing pressure to be released across the rest of the body.
When only the very best prevention, support and therapy are required, the Air-Lo 5 AlternatingOverlay is the best value choice for safely caring for patients assessed at medium to high risk.
High quality two way stretch top cover is fully welded and can be high temperature
washed for total infection control.
All waterfalls are turned and welded for maximum infection control and zip protection.
Mattress elastics securely bond the overlay to any standard single mattress.
18 transverse air cells alternate to provide maximum prevention and therapy.
Static head section eliminates patient dizziness and disorientation.
Medical grade power cord is run inside the mattress to avoid dangerous threading under the bed or on the floor.
A state of the art, internal air release valve is directly connected to the computer for instant response.
It’s high capacity ensures the fastest release of pressure possible.
Choice of three care modes and comfort settings in a simple to operate digital control unit with tamper proof lockout, static time-outs and simple diagnostics. Intermittent operation ensures long pump life.
High capacity yet unobtrusive side CPR release gives maximum
safety in the event of pulmonary emergency.
Cell disconnection valves allow the end four foot cells to be
completely deflated to assist in suspending a patient’s heels.
Tilt Sensor automatically adds more pressure when patient is inclined.

8The Air-Lo 8 Alternating Mattress Replacement leads the field in affordable prevention of pressure areas and skin breakdowns.
It’s compact, powerful yet almost silent control unit can quickly support patient loads of up to 180kg whilst alternately allowing pressure to be released across the rest of the body.
When only the very best prevention, support and therapy are required, the Air-Lo 8 Mattress Replacement is the best value choice for safely caring for patients assessed at high risk.
High quality two way stretch top cover is fully welded and can be high temperature washed for total infection control.
High capacity yet unobtrusive side CPR release gives
maximum safety in the event of pulminary emergency. This new design can easily be opened or closed without having to un-zip
the top cover.
Medical grade power cord is run inside the mattress to avoid dangerous
threading under the bed or on the floor.
Cell disconnection valves allow the top two thirds of the end
four foot cells to be completely deflated to fully suspend
a patient heels.
A state of the art, internal air release valve is directly connected to the computer for instant response.
It’s high capacity ensures the fastest release of pressure possible.
Choice of three care modes and comfort settings in a simple to operate digital control unit with tamper proof lockout, static timeouts and simple diagnostics. Intermittent operation ensures long pump life.
All waterfalls are turned and welded for maximum infection control and zip protection
20 transverse air cells alternate to provide maximum prevention and therapy.
They also feature permanently inflated safety sections for total peace of mind.
Static head section eliminates patient dizziness and disorientation.

Breakthrough pressure release technology just got wider! All the advantages of the original Theraflow alternating mattress replacement have been designed into this new extended support system recommended for patients weighing from 40 to 180kg.
Enhanced Patient SupportAdditional, static side cells provide additional support to the to patients especially during transfers and repositioning.The new Theraflow King Single can fit any standard king single bed measuring around 105 to 110 cm in width.
New Cellstay Support CoverletA robust side skirt design integrated into the coverlet binds the whole mattress together increasing the system’s ability to support a variety of patient loads safely and securely.
Microfibre Foam for Enhanced TherapyThe coverlet is constructed with a 5cm layer of hyperstretch open cell foam which in turn is coated with a microfibre material similar to that used in high performance athletic wear to wick moisture away from the body.The coverlet therefore not only insulates the patient from “Cell Chill” but also from any excess moisture buildup. The thin foam layer also assists in avoiding reperfusion injury in patients at high risk of sub-dermal vascular damage.Turbocharged DeflationThe patented dynamulink cell design uses elasticised members to transfer the power of inflating cells to force down the deflating sets.This alternately removes almost all interface pressure under nearly 80% of the patient’s bodyThe at risk heel area is completely elevated for nearly 30% of the alternation cycle.This unique cell design allows cell pairs to naturally remain upright when normal cells deform or collapse under patient weight.
